Pro stress-test →Serica Energy is a UK-based independent upstream oil and gas exploration and production company focused on the North Sea. The company identifies, acquires, and exploits oil and gas reserves, with operations spanning multiple fields including Bruce, Keith, Rhum, and Columbus. Serica is a significant contributor to UK energy security, supplying approximately 5% of the nation's natural gas.
Strategic Profile
Pro stress-test →Serica operates a diversified portfolio of producing and development assets across the UK North Sea, with a strategic focus on maximizing cash generation from its asset base. The company faces regulatory headwinds from the Windfall Tax (Energy Profits Levy) but has demonstrated operational resilience through disciplined cost management and production optimization. Its competitive position is strengthened by mature, low-cost production assets and a high dividend yield strategy.
Competitive Landscape
Pro stress-test →Serica competes with other independent North Sea producers and major integrated oil companies operating in UK waters. Key competitors include BP, Shell, and other regional independents. Serica's differentiation lies in its focused portfolio of mature, cash-generative assets and cost discipline, though it lacks the scale and diversification of larger peers. Regulatory parity with major operators creates a level playing field on the Windfall Tax despite size disadvantages.
